Based on messages Im getting here and on other forums where I have shown the leather chopper mitts I have been making there appears to be interest by folks wanting to purchase them. For as long as I have been making things (like knives) I have shied away from selling stuff for a variety of reasons but in the case of these leather mitts, I am considering selling them. The problem is what to charge. We are a like minded bunch so help me out here. My material costs per pair is $25. (leather, fur trim, Fleece material for liners, thread) Leather is the most expensive item (leather prices are crazy high in the volume I would buy). I didnt factor in the overhead like the electricity to sew them and print patterns and art work. It takes me 5 hours to make a pair of mitts (a right and left mitt and a right and left liner). If I work for $15 an hours x 5 hours that’s $75 + $25 in materials and Im at $100 per pair and frankly I don’t see people paying $100 for a pair of leather mittens no matter how cool they look. You can go to Fleet Farm and buy a pair of leather mitts for $20. At the same time there is a company out west selling this same sort of product for $200 a pair. ($225 for finger gloves) I know the obvious, streamline and modernize the process to make them faster. Find lower cost sources for materials. I am doing those things.
